Local history helps children make sense of their immediate world. However, it is not just a case of bombarding them with local facts. Good local history involves enquiries that allow children to investigate drawing on their previous historical knowledge and understanding.

Teaching local history can help children develop a sense of identity and belonging, promote critical thinking and historical research skills, and be used to teach other subject areas such as geography, science, and art.
